Microsoft Faces Lawsuit in Australia Over Allegedly Misleading Users on Copilot Pricing
- Monday October 27, 2025
- Written by Akash Dutta, Edited by Ketan Pratap
Microsoft is facing a lawsuit in Australia after the ACCC accused it of misleading Microsoft 365 subscribers. The regulator claims Microsoft failed to mention that users could keep their old plan at the same price without Copilot AI features. Instead, subscribers were told to pay higher prices or cancel. Microsoft Sued For "Misleading" 2.7 Million Australians About Subscriptions
- Monday October 27, 2025
- World News | Agence France-Presse
Microsoft is accused of making "false or misleading" statements to around 2.7 million Australians who subscribe by auto-renewal to Microsoft 365 plans, which include a suite of online Office services.

Microsoft Announces $3.2 Billion Investment In Australia
- Tuesday October 24, 2023
- World News | Agence France-Presse
Microsoft announced Tuesday a Aus$5 billion (US$3.2 billion) investment in Australia focused on cloud computing and artificial intelligence, saying it would boost the country's economy and cyber defences.
